Industry Placement is an experiential learning program for undergraduate students. It is conducted within a partnership arrangement between industry and the university and is designed to offer high achieving students the opportunity to gain valuable experience in a professional workplace environment while they continue their study at university.
Our Industry Placement program has been operating for over 40 years and is one of our most important teaching features at the Faculty of Design.
Students are chosen to participate in Industry Placement on the basis of their academic abilities and level of maturity to enter the workplace. They are placed locally, nationally and internationally in a workplace relevant to their area of study and intended future career for 24 or 48 weeks.
